Jill Biden has paid tribute to her husband after he withdrew from the presidential race on Sunday.
Releasing a statement on Sunday, Mr Biden said he believed it was in the “best interest of my party and the country for me to stand down and to focus solely on fulfilling the duties as President for the remainder of my term”.
He posted the statement to X, with his wife retweeting it with two heart emojis.
Media figures, Democratic operatives and an ever-increasing number of elected politicians, including the party’s senior most leaders, called for Mr Biden’s exit from the campaign in recent weeks, believing him incapable of winning the general election on November 5.
The 81-year-old’s decision to withdraw comes after, and largely because of, his halting performance in a televised debate against Mr Trump on June 27, which reinforced existing concerns about his age and mental acuity, and sparked a sense of “panic” inside the Democratic Party.
Previously Mr Biden had been defiant in the face of calls for him to step down.
Mr Biden spent the immediate aftermath of his catastrophic debate performance privately considering his position, including during a meeting with family members at the presidential retreat, Camp David, on June 30.
According to media reports, Dr Biden, the President’s son Hunter and multiple grandchildren offered their support, telling Mr Biden he should remain in the race.
They reportedly discussed the possibility of adjusting Mr Biden’s staff, implicitly blaming his advisers for the poor debate.
But the damage was done. Mr Biden’s halting demeanour on stage, viewed by tens of millions of American voters, saw him stumble over his words, appear confused at times, and repeatedly struggle to form a coherent argument for his re-election.
By contrast, Mr Trump was relatively disciplined and cogent, by his standards.
On the night of the debate, after he had left the stage, Mr Biden appeared at a watch party with his wife, Dr Biden, who heaped praise on his performance. But in the eyes of many viewers, she only infantilised him in the process.
“Joe, you did such a great job, answering every question. You knew all the facts,” said Dr Biden, in a tone reminiscent of the one she’d use in her job as a teacher.
